I tried this place out because it had a 4.0 overall score and a sushi buffet.
When we get in, the host tells us about hot pot being included for $23.99. $24 for hot pot, sushi, and buffet seems like a good price.
The buffet part is probably one of the top worst Chinese Buffets I have ever had. They had some good stuff, like the Chinese donuts and the dessert section. Some stuff was fresh, while the plantains, octopus, and calamari tasted old and dry (no way they were fresh, tasted as if they were a few days old and reheated). That was a disappointment mainly. The buffet is supposed to be the strong point, not the weak one.
The sushi would have been good, if the rice was fresh. Very first sushi I have ever had where the rice tasted really dry and once again, old and not fresh. With rice being cheap, sushi rice should be the number one fresh thing. But, it was not as bad as the buffet
The hot pot was the best part of this deal. All the uncooked pieces were fresh, and the broth tasted decent. The restaurant also has a sauce section with many choices. If they just did hot pot and made that part better, maybe the place would do better. But, I was the only one using the hot pot. No one else touched that area.
Now, the atmosphere. Huge place, very nice. No customers. Or very very few customers. Seems strange for a place with a lot of choices. But the main thing is price, as buffets are supposed to offer value as well as options.
The total cost was almost $70 dollars for two people. They now charge 15% mandatory tip, where a few months ago people complained it was 12%. Nope, they heard your complaints and raised it to 15%.
They have no menu, and the waiter was the worst. When we asked for drinks, they said they carried soda and the beer menu was on the table. They never mentioned they had Ramune, which I would have gotten if they mentioned it. I got raspberry tea,which they charged $3.00 for, which is the most I have ever paid for iced tea ever.
Overall a disappointment, and I am not surprised such a huge and nice looking place has almost no customers. And this was around dinner time by the way, at 5pm! That is when a restaurant in Cleveland should be getting busy.
Would not recommend....based on the price and value. There was another Buffet across the street called Fuji that I might try next time.

Recently went there with some friends. Food was okay what you'd expect from a Chinese buffet. Our server did a good job. Keeping our beverages full and clearing dirty plates. Problem with this place is they automatically add gratuity onto your check. There are no signs and it is not advertised that they add gratuity to your check. I prefer to have my own choice on the amount of tip I'm going to leave not have it forced upon me. My friend that was sitting at the table with us with his family went up and had to gratuity removed from his bill. So just a bit of information that you can do that. There is also a spot on your receipt that you can write in a tip but this would be on top of the gratuity that they already added. I wonder how many people they are ripping off with this scam.

The food is great at this establishment. As one person mentioned, they have a large selection of food to choose from including an entire section of various meats and vegetables to use on a hot pot. Some of the tables had burners for hot pots built into them. The food was warm at the buffet and wasn't overcooked or undercooked like some buffets. The staff is nice and courteous as well. However, this place is overpriced. I came out with a bill of $70 for one child and one adult. Most Asian buffets have a separate price for the child based off of age, but this place does not. My daughter was charged for the price of a regular dinner buffet. Also, they have takeout containers available, but until I was checking out I didn't know they charged extra for the food to go. There was not a sign next to the take out containers explaining those had a separate cost. They also make you pay a 12% gratuity tip for a waitress that only brought out our drinks and gave us the check. She didn't serve us food or have to take our order because it is a BUFFET. Therefore, the requirement of a tip is asinine.

Almost everything is OLD and salty. The shrimps are mushy like mud. You'd know it was not fresh before they make the dish. Shrimps are supposed to be kinda tender and chewy if they are fresh, taste sweet. These are not that. Orange chicken is extremely dry and salty, means it's very old. Been sitting on the warmer for hours. Flounder is crunchy and old , very oily because they probably redo it a few times today. Clams, crawfish, and steam fish are not bad. Lo mein tastes like it was made yesterday and been on the warmer ever since. It's dried out to the point it's shriveled to be half size of what the fresh lo mein is. Deep fried plantain is old and dried out too. I'm not surprised that's why I only see 3 or 4 table, under 10 pp total, are there at dinner time on a Friday.
